3 DTD THE CORDELT B eta Omicron began the semester initiating four young men into our brotherhood. Each new member is excited to grow with Delta Tau Delta and to lend our chapter their talents. Together we're maintaining a strong legacy of leadership at Cornell. HOMECOMING REUNITES GENERATIONS In early October, Beta Omicron celebrated Homecoming with the whole chapter tirelessly organizing the weekend's festivities. The alumni versus actives football game was one of the more spirited games we've seen in recent years. While we conceded our loss to the alumni, the actives managed to put up a good fight with a large turnout. ENGAGING THE ITHACA COMMUNITY We continue pushing philanthropic efforts, especially when it comes to community service. There have been more channels to engage with the Ithaca community, ranging from our monthly Enfield Elementary School visits to our bi-weekly loaves and fish's engagements. Brothers hope to keep improving as we always strive to make our community a better, safer, and healthier environment. CHAPTER RECEIVES AWARD FROM DELT CONFERENCE Academic efforts at Beta Omicron are flourishing as our current 3.32 GPA surpassed the campus average. This demonstrates an upward trend from past semesters, and we hope to keep climbing. The national fraternity took note of our rapid improvement in focusing on studies and granted us the Academic Excellence Award at the 2019 Northeastern Divisional Conference held in February.
